In accordance with RNP's Mission Statement, Philosophy of Client Care and Code of Ethics as stated in the Personnel Policies and under the supervision of the Program Director, the Peer Outreach Specialist serves as an advocate and outreach specialist to support the clients of the Population of Focus (POF). The program’s goal is to provide services to more individuals from Fairfield County with SUD and COD so they may receive housing, addiction, and mental health services in order to decrease homelessness and illicit drug use including individuals from diverse racial, ethnic, sexual and gender minorities communities. SPECIFIC D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: All duties are subject to accommodation in accordance with the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A). Responsible for conducting outreach activities and supportive services through community engagement. Utilizes RNP vehicle for outreach events, community engagement and client transportation for access to services. Facilitates timely referrals and placements to treatment and support providers. Conducts coaching sessions with individuals referred to RNP programs for community networking. Maintains communication with all RNP programs for admissions and referrals. Acts as a role model for the organization with individuals in the community and when serving clients. Prepares an agenda for supervision and utilizes supervision as needed to meet professional demands of job. Maintains professional communication with community providers and builds a network of recovery supports. Maintains files and records of work activities to provide access to and retrieval of data while meeting all document requirements of position and program. Engages with individuals and families into care and offer prevention, engagement, and recovery support services Assumes all other appropriate duties as deemed necessary by supervisor.
